Mendota City, California


Mendota City, California is a city of the Fresno County, California, United States. As per the 2000 census, city has a population of 7890 inhabitants. According to July 2008 Census Bureau estimates, the population of the city is 10339, It is the 495th most populous in the U.S. state of California. The city encompasses an area of 1.87 sq mi (4.84 square kilometre), makes it the 259th smallest by total area in California.

As of the census of 2000, there were 7890 people in the city, organized into 1825 households, and 1545 families living in the city. The population density was 4229.4 people per square mile (1632.98/kmē), giving it the 255th most densely populated city among the California. There were 1878 housing units at an average density of 1004.3 per square mile (387.76/kmē). The average household size was 4.32 persons, and the average family size was 4.38 persons. Age range in the city was well distributed with 33.9% under the age of 18, 15.3% from 18 to 24, 30.9% from 25 to 44, 14.7% from 45 to 64, and 5.2% who were 65 or older. For every 100 females there were 130.2 males.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 142 males. The median age of the city's population was 25.4 years, The median age of males was 25.4 years, for females the median age was 25.4 years. The racial makeup of the city was 2156 White, 52 Black or African American, 103 American Indian, 57 Asian, 13 Native Hawaiian, 529 from two or more races and 4980 Ohter races.

The median income for a household in the city was $23705, it is California's 71st poorest city by median household income. The median income for a family in the city was $22984, making it the 33rd lowest city by median family income in California. The per capita income for the city was $6967, it is 22nd poorest city by per capita income in California. The median income was $9149, The median income for males was $10831 versus $6918 for females.

In 2000, 2369 pupils and students, of which 48.8% are male and 51.2% are female, 30.03% of the total population, are in the education system. Of which, percentage of enrollment student are in, 3.38% nursery or pri school, 6.25% kindergarten, 42.04% elementary school, 33.31% high school and 15.03% College graduate school.
